What is Sonic?
Founded in 1994 and headquartered in Santa Rosa, California, Sonic is a provider of Internet and wireless connectivity solutions for both residential and business clients. The company has built a reputation for delivering reliable broadband and telecommunications services, catering to the evolving digital needs of its customer base. Sonic's strategic focus on infrastructure and service quality positions it as a key player in its regional market, enabling robust connectivity for homes and enterprises alike.
How much funding has Sonic raised?
Sonic has raised a total of $5M across 1 funding round:
Debt
$5M
Debt (2020): $5M with participation from PPP
